Abstract
We have modified the technique of perigraft-to-right atrial shunt to control hemorrhage after aortic root replacement. We have performed this operation in 2 patients, including one who had acute aortic dissection and another who underwent aortic root replacement and single-vessel coronary artery bypass. Neither patient required re-exploration for bleeding, and both shunts closed spontaneously during the follow-up period without any related complications. With this modification, even in the presence of concomitant coronary artery bypass grafting, hemostasis was achieved with preservation of the proximal vein graft.Entities:
